CaRh3B2 crystallizes in the hexagonal P6/mmm space group. The structure is three-dimensional. Ca is bonded in a 12-coordinate geometry to two equivalent Ca, twelve equivalent Rh, and six equivalent B atoms. Both Ca–Ca bond lengths are 2.93 Å. All Ca–Rh bond lengths are 3.17 Å. All Ca–B bond lengths are 3.24 Å. Rh is bonded in a distorted square co-planar geometry to four equivalent Ca and four equivalent B atoms. All Rh–B bond lengths are 2.19 Å. B is bonded in a 6-coordinate geometry to three equivalent Ca and six equivalent Rh atoms.
